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your warehouse. This includes identifying the source of the water, evaluating the extent of the damage, and developing a strategy to dry and clean the area. Our team will work closely with you to ensure you’re informed every step of the way. We’ll assess the damage thoroughly, and our plan will be tailored to your specific needs.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to extract the water from your warehouse.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and reducing downtime. Our technicians will work efficiently to complete this step as quickly as possible. We’ll extract the water safely and efficiently, reducing disruption to your business.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your warehouse. This includes using desiccants and industrial fans to speed up the drying process. Our team will work closely with you to ensure the area is dry and safe for occupancy. We’ll dry and dehumidify your warehouse quickly and effectively, preventing further dam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will clean and sanitize your warehouse to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. This includes using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ining water and debris. Our technicians will work efficiently to complete this step as quickly as possible. We’ll clean and sanitize your warehouse thoroughly, ensuring a safe and healthy environment.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Our team will work with you to restore your warehouse to its original condition. This includes repairing any dam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as replacing any necessary materials. Warehouse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Standing water exceeds 2 inches No Yes Excess water can cause further damage and create a safety hazard.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ew can be hazardous to your health and need specialized equipment to remove.
Damage to structural elements (e.g., walls, floors) No Yes Structural damage can compromise the integrity of your property and need professional attention.
Discoloration or stains on walls or ceilings No Yes Discoloration or stains can show water damage and need professional attention to prevent further damage.
Water damage is widespread (e.g., multiple rooms affected) No Yes Widespread water damage can be overwhelming and need professional attention to ensure a thorough restoration.
Insurance claim is involved No Yes Insurance claims need professional documentation and attention to ensure a smooth claims process.

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Cost in Hudson Oaks, TX

The cost of Warehouse Water Damage Restoration can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hudson Oaks, TX.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Call us now to schedule an assessment and get a more accurate est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water extracted
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ions used
Restoration and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ials replaced
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Complexity of job, time spent on assessment
Equipment Rental $500 – $2,000 Type and duration of equipment rental
